About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Lead the technical vision, design, and implementation of database products for internal needs
  • Create cloud-agnostic abstractions and software infrastructure across AWS, Azure, and GCP
  • Drive complex, cross-functional engineering initiatives from inception to production
  • Mentor junior and mid-level engineers
  • Establish software engineering best practices
  • Harden database infrastructure to meet uptime, security, and durability SLAs
  • Participate in an on-call rotation
  • Lead incident investigations for complex production issues
  • Direct blameless post-mortems to drive permanent systemic improvements
  • Partner with Security, Infrastructure, and Site Reliability Engineering teams to support new product capabilities at scale

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• US Citizenship or Lawful Permanent Resident (Green Card holder) required due to compliance requirements
  • BS, MS, or PhD in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, or a related technical field, or equivalent professional experience
  • 7–12 years of professional experience designing, building, operating, and scaling large-scale backend distributed systems in high-growth production environments
  • Understanding of databases, including PostgreSQL and Redis
  • Experience running large-scale distributed systems
  • Strong hands-on coding experience in Go, Java, C++, or Rust
  • Extensive experience architecting infrastructure on AWS, GCP, or Azure
  • Experience with cloud networking constructs such as VPC peering, PrivateLink, and Transit Gateways
  • Proficiency in Terraform, Kubernetes, Ansible, or CloudFormation
  • Proven track record of technical ownership, breaking down ambiguous problems into concrete roadmaps, and delivering high-impact projects across multiple engineering teams
